At the Bendigo Joss House Temple we rely on grants, funding, sponsorship and donations to ensure the on-going maintenance of our heritage site. We are pleased to acknowledge the fantastic support that we receive.

The Bendigo Joss House Temple is here today thanks to these key supporters:

  • Our dedicated and passionate team of volunteers
  • Bendigo Heritage – Who manage and oversee the daily operations
  • The City of Greater Bendigo – Who assist with the running expenses of the site
  • The National Trust of Australia (Victoria) – Who returned the Joss House to its former glory and reopened the site to worshippers and visitors in 1972. The restoration began back in 1959.

Celebrating
150 years

Opened in 1871, 2021 marked the 150th anniversary of the Bendigo Joss House Temple. The heritage-listed temple is significant as being one of the few remaining buildings of its type in Australia.
